Output e3c60225d7e830d123cf94787c5087138d2a00aecf472c151f4703b5078f42ba:0

value
57183344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bdaea451a17b282f34fa8e6e2e98f7d801b102 OP_EQUAL
address
3HM6hhMxF3AbSky4MS1TSm875UH5B3miTA
transaction
e3c60225d7e830d123cf94787c5087138d2a00aecf472c151f4703b5078f42ba
spent
true